CORE PURPOSE

We require an enterprising commercially minded Business Teacher to deliver high-quality business studies and enterprise instruction across Key Stage 4 and Key Stage 5 (A-Level and Vocational Technical qualifications). Operating within a vibrant secondary academy the successful candidate will bridge the gap between academic theory and corporate practice embedding financial management marketing strategies and operational frameworks into the curriculum to prepare all pupils thoroughly for terminal examinations and future corporate or entrepreneurial careers.

KEY TASKS & DAILY OPERATIONS
  • Applied Business Instruction: Plan and execute conceptually robust business lessons linking theoretical modelssuch as the marketing mix cash-flow forecasting supply chain logistics and organizational structuresdirectly to contemporary corporate operations.

  • Vocational and Academic Delivery: Teach across diverse specification pathways seamlessly managing the distinct pedagogical demands of both traditional essay-led A-Level Business modules and portfolio-based Level 3 technical qualifications.

  • Rigorous Examination Preparation: Guide Key Stage 4 and Key Stage 5 cohorts systematically through terminal assessment criteria explicitly training pupils in the data-response analysis calculation metrics and evaluation skills required for top-tier marks.

  • Data-Led Progress Interventions: Implement targeted formative assessment routines utilizing regular diagnostic tracking to pinpoint specific areas of misconception and deploying immediate structured retrieval interventions to maximize student growth.

  • Professional Pastoral Mentorship: Fulfill full form tutor responsibilities within an established pastoral structure supporting pupils with academic tracking career mapping personal statement development and the cultivation of professional workplace soft skills.

PROFILE REQUIREMENTS
  • Qualifications: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or a recognized equivalent teaching credential paired with a strong honors degree in Business Studies Management Finance Economics or a closely related commercial discipline.

  • Pedagogical Capability: A proven track record or clear capacity to secure excellent progress metrics in terminal public business examinations and technical course submissions through explicit context-first business pedagogy.

  • Commercial Literacy: A strong understanding of contemporary corporate and macroeconomic environments with the ability to confidently integrate real-world case studies of modern startups multinational corporations and digital business frameworks into daily tuition.
